小程序选用什么服务器
-
选择服务器对于小程序来说是一个重要的决策,因为服务器的性能和稳定性直接影响到小程序的用户体验和运行效果。那么如何选择适合的服务器呢?下面是一些选择服务器的考虑因素以及推荐的服务器选项。
首先,需要考虑的是小程序的规模和需求。如果小程序只是一个简单的个人项目或者只有少量用户访问,那么选择一台轻量级的虚拟主机可能就足够了。但如果小程序是一个大型的商业项目,拥有大量用户和复杂的业务逻辑,那么可能需要选择一台专用服务器或者使用云计算平台。
其次,需要考虑的是服务器的性能和稳定性。一台性能较好的服务器能够提供更快的响应速度和更好的用户体验,而稳定性则决定了服务器的可靠性和可用性。在选择服务器时,可以参考一些常用的性能指标,如处理器的型号和频率、内存的大小、硬盘的类型和容量等。另外,还可以了解服务器供应商的信誉和客户评价,以确保选择到可靠的服务器。
第三,需要考虑的是服务器的地理位置和网络延迟。服务器的地理位置决定了用户访问服务器的物理距离,而网络延迟则决定了用户与服务器之间的通信速度。为了提供更好的用户体验,建议选择离用户群体较近的服务器,以减少网络延迟。
根据以上考虑因素,以下是一些推荐的服务器选项:
-
虚拟主机:适用于规模较小的个人项目或少量用户访问。推荐选择知名的虚拟主机提供商,如阿里云、腾讯云、亚马逊AWS等。
-
专用服务器:适用于大型商业项目或需要较高性能和稳定性的应用。推荐选择知名的服务器提供商,如华为、戴尔等。
-
云计算平台:适用于需要灵活性和可扩展性的项目。推荐选择知名的云计算平台,如阿里云、腾讯云、微软Azure等。
总之,选择适合的服务器对于小程序的运行效果和用户体验至关重要。需要综合考虑小程序的规模和需求、服务器的性能和稳定性、地理位置和网络延迟等因素,选择合适的服务器选项。
1年前 -
-
在开发小程序时,选择合适的服务器是至关重要的。以下是几种常见的小程序服务器选项:
-
云服务器(Cloud Hosting)
云服务器是将应用程序部署在云基础设施上的一种选项。云服务器提供了弹性扩展和高可用性,可以根据需要轻松地增加或减少服务器的容量。常见的云服务器提供商包括亚马逊AWS、微软Azure和谷歌云等。 -
虚拟私有服务器(Virtual Private Server)
虚拟私有服务器是将一个物理服务器划分为多个虚拟服务器的方式。每个虚拟服务器都拥有独立的操作系统和资源,可以实现更好的隔离和安全性。虚拟私有服务器提供了更多的控制权和自定义选项,并且价格相对较低。 -
使用微信小程序云开发(WeChat Mini Program Cloud Development)
微信小程序云开发是由微信官方提供的一种全套后端解决方案。它提供了数据库存储、云函数和存储等功能,可以快速搭建一个简单的小程序服务器。微信小程序云开发具有极低的学习成本和开发门槛,适合初学者和小型项目。 -
自建服务器
自建服务器是将服务器建立在自己的硬件设备上,可以全面掌控服务器的配置和性能。自建服务器需要自己购买硬件设备,设置服务器操作系统和网络环境,需要有一定的技术知识和维护成本。 -
第三方服务器托管服务
还有一些第三方服务提供商专门为小程序提供服务器托管服务。它们提供了简便的一键式部署和管理界面,使开发者无需关注服务器的底层细节。常见的第三方服务器托管服务提供商包括Heroku、DigitalOcean和Linode等。
在选择服务器时,需要考虑项目的规模、性能要求、安全性和预算等因素。同时,应该注意服务器的地理位置,选择距离用户较近的服务器能够提供更低的延迟和更好的用户体验。
1年前 -
-
选择什么类型的服务器取决于小程序的需求和预算。以下是一些常见的服务器选项:
-
云服务器:
云服务器是目前最受欢迎的服务器选择之一。云服务器提供灵活的资源配置,可以根据需求调整计算能力、存储空间和带宽等。另外,用户只需支付他们所使用的资源,因此云服务器适合预算有限的小程序。 -
虚拟私有服务器(VPS):
VPS是一种虚拟化技术,将一台物理服务器划分为多个虚拟服务器,每个VPS都有自己独立的操作系统和资源。与云服务器相比,VPS提供的资源更为稳定和可靠,但灵活性较弱。 -
分布式服务器:
分布式服务器由多台服务器组成,可以共同处理用户请求和数据存储。分布式服务器能提供更高的容错性和可扩展性,适合处理大量用户或高访问流量的小程序。 -
客户端服务器(B/S架构):
在B/S架构下,服务器主要负责提供数据和逻辑处理。小程序的客户端(如浏览器或移动端应用)负责呈现界面和处理用户输入。这种架构通常使用Web服务器,如Apache或Nginx。 -
容器化服务器:
容器化服务器使用容器技术,如Docker,将应用程序和其依赖项打包为容器。容器可以轻松地在不同环境中部署和运行,提供更高的灵活性和可移植性。
无论选择哪种服务器,都需要考虑以下因素:
- 预算:云服务器和VPS相对较便宜,而分布式服务器和容器化服务器可能需要更高的投资。
- 性能:根据小程序的需求,选择适当的计算能力和网络带宽。
- 可靠性:服务器的可用性和容错性对于小程序的稳定性和可靠性至关重要。
总之,选择适合的服务器取决于小程序的需求和预算,应综合考虑各种因素,权衡各项利弊后做出决策。
1年前 -